Healthy, inspected Philodendron Summer Glory in a 3" nursery pot.

Philodendron Summer Glory is a striking hybrid Philodendron known for its glossy green foliage, warm bronze-toned new growth, and red to pink petioles.

This starter plant is small now, but it can grow into a fuller tropical foliage plant over time. It does best with bright indirect light, well-draining soil, and moderate moisture without staying soggy.

Great for Philodendron collectors or anyone looking for a colorful tropical foliage starter with unique petiole color and strong grow-out potential.

• Size: 3" nursery pot  
• Light: Bright, indirect light  
• Water: Allow the top of the soil to dry slightly between watering  
• Growth: Upright to spreading tropical foliage growth  
• Care: Easy to moderate; avoid overwatering and cold drafts
